网络爬虫作为数据采集的重要工具,广泛应用于信息搜集。本文揭秘网络爬虫在数据采集中的得力助手角色,展示其在信息搜集领域的强大能力。
本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网的快速发展,数据已成为企业、政府、科研机构等众多领域的核心资产,而网络爬虫作为一种高效的数据采集工具,其在数据采集领域的应用日益广泛,本文将深入探讨网络爬虫在数据采集中的作用及其优势。
网络爬虫的定义
网络爬虫(Web Crawler)是一种模拟人类行为,自动从互联网上获取信息的程序,它通过分析网页结构,提取网页内容,并将有价值的信息存储到数据库中,网络爬虫可以按照一定的策略有针对性地抓取数据,满足不同用户的需求。
网络爬虫在数据采集中的应用
1、竞品分析
企业通过网络爬虫可以实时获取竞争对手的产品信息、价格、促销活动等数据,从而制定有针对性的市场策略。
2、行业报告
网络爬虫可以抓取各大行业网站、论坛、新闻等平台的数据,为政府、企业、研究机构提供行业发展趋势、政策法规等有价值的信息。
3、搜索引擎优化(SEO)
网络爬虫可以分析网站关键词、页面质量、链接结构等,为网站优化提供数据支持,提高网站在搜索引擎中的排名。
4、社交媒体分析
网络爬虫可以抓取微博、微信、抖音等社交媒体平台的数据,分析用户喜好、传播趋势等,为企业提供市场洞察。
图片来源于网络,如有侵权联系删除
5、金融市场分析
网络爬虫可以抓取各大金融网站、论坛、新闻等平台的数据,分析市场走势、政策法规等,为投资者提供决策依据。
6、知识图谱构建
网络爬虫可以抓取互联网上的各类信息,为构建知识图谱提供数据支持,有助于挖掘数据之间的关联关系。
网络爬虫的优势
1、高效性
网络爬虫可以自动化、大规模地抓取数据,节省人力、物力成本,提高数据采集效率。
2、实时性
网络爬虫可以实时抓取数据,为用户提供最新、最全面的信息。
3、灵活性
网络爬虫可以根据用户需求定制抓取策略,满足不同场景下的数据采集需求。
图片来源于网络,如有侵权联系删除
4、成本低
相较于传统的人工数据采集方式,网络爬虫具有较低的成本优势。
网络爬虫的挑战与应对策略
1、数据质量
网络爬虫抓取的数据可能存在噪声、重复等问题,需要通过数据清洗、去重等手段提高数据质量。
2、法律风险
网络爬虫在抓取数据时可能涉及版权、隐私等问题,需要遵守相关法律法规,确保数据采集的合法性。
3、技术挑战
网络爬虫在抓取数据时可能遇到反爬虫机制、网页结构复杂等问题,需要不断优化爬虫技术,提高抓取成功率。
网络爬虫作为一种高效的数据采集工具,在数据采集领域具有广泛的应用前景,面对挑战,我们需要不断创新技术、完善法律法规,确保网络爬虫在数据采集中的健康发展。
评论列表